Arabic
Root
س ل ف • (s-l-f)
- related to taking, giving and the passing of things
Derived terms
- Verbs and verbal derivatives
- Form I: سَلَفَ (salafa, “to happen, pass by, take place; to get ahead; to flatten; to smear”)
- Verbal noun: سَلَف (salaf, “an interest-free loan, a good deed, an advanced payment”)
- Active participle: سَالِف (sālif, “antecedent, precedent; sideburns”)
- Passive participle: مَسْلُوف (maslūf)
- Form II: سَلَّفَ (sallafa, “to have a snack, (with ه (h)) to give a snack to a host; (with ه (h)) to lend money”)
- Verbal noun: تَسْلِيف (taslīf, “borrowing, loan, advance”)
- Active participle: مُسَلِّف (musallif)
- Passive participle: مُسَلَّف (musallaf, “advanced, lent, loan”)
- Form III: سَالَفَ (sālafa, “(with ه (h)) to surpass, reach; to walk along with; to precede”)
- Verbal noun: مُسَالَفَة (musālafa), سِلَاف (silāf)
- Active participle: مُسَالِف (musālif)
- Passive participle: مُسَالَف (musālaf)
- Form IV: أَسْلَفَ (ʾaslafa, “to flatten, rake; to loan”)
- Verbal noun: إِسْلَاف (ʾislāf)
- Active participle: مُسْلِف (muslif)
- Passive participle: مُسْلَف (muslaf, “advanced, lent, loaned”)
- Form V: تَسَلَّفَ (tasallafa, “(with من + ه (h)) to get a loan, borrow”)
- Verbal noun: تَسَلُّف (tasalluf)
- Active participle: مُتَسَلِّف (mutasallif, “calculated, premeditated”)
- Passive participle: مُتَسَلَّف (mutasallaf)
- Form VI: تَسَالَفَ (tasālafa, “to marry (two men with two sisters)”)
- Verbal noun: تَسَالُف (tasāluf)
- Active participle: مُتَسَالِف (mutasālif)
- Passive participle: مُتَسَالَف (mutasālaf)
- Form VIII: اِسْتَلَفَ (istalafa, “to ask for a loan or an advanced sum of money”)
- Verbal noun: اِسْتِلَاف (istilāf, “advance, loan, borrowing”)
- Active participle: مُسْتَلِف (mustalif, “borrowed, taken in advance”)
- Passive participle: مُسْتَلَف (mustalaf)
